Best Booth Awards
FITUR wishes to recognize the effort and talent of exhibiting companies and organizations through these "Best Stand" awards, which are given, at the discretion of a committee made up of experts in marketing, image, ephemeral architecture and communication, to stands that stand out for their adaptation to the marketing needs of the product presented, the identification of the design with the image and brand of the company and its products.
Originality and innovative aspects.
That is to say, in assigning the prizes, the construction of the stand, its shapes, materials and innovative aspects, its design to impact the public and represent the identity of the exhibiting company or entity and its structure to enable the proper functioning of the stand in the tasks of the fair are taken into account. The members of the committee go through the entire fair and choose the stands that, in their opinion, deserve to be highlighted with these "Best Stand" awards that FITUR grants in recognition of their work.

Sustainable Stands Award
For the eighth time, FITUR is launching the "Sustainable Stand" Award, organized in collaboration with the Responsible Tourism Institute (RTI), with the aim of recognizing and highlighting the efforts of exhibiting companies to ensure that their presence at FITUR is environmentally and climate-friendly, contributes to social and cultural development, and serves as a benchmark for governance and economic sustainability.
- Announcement
FITUR, in collaboration with the Responsible Tourism Institute (RTI), announces the FITUR 2027 Sustainable Stand Award. This award recognizes the most sustainable practices adopted by exhibitors participating in the trade fair.
Sustainability will be assessed across its three dimensions (economic, social, and environmental), covering the entire lifecycle of participation in the trade fair, from preparation through to its conclusion and dismantling.
Through this initiative, FITUR reaffirms its commitment to making the exhibition and meetings industry a benchmark in sustainability, promoting the dissemination and adoption of best practices applicable to all types of events.
- Participants
All companies holding a stand at FITUR, that is, the trade fair’s direct exhibitors, are eligible to participate.
- How to participate
Direct exhibitors at FITUR wishing to participate must complete and submit the questionnaire published HERE and, if deemed necessary by the organizers, allow a verification visit during the trade fair.
The questionnaire must be fully completed in all its sections and include the relevant descriptions when referring to the sustainability practices implemented. Otherwise, the corresponding section will not be evaluated.
The deadline for submitting the questionnaire is January 21, 2027, at 7:00 p.m. (end of the second day of the trade fair).
- Jury
The jury will be composed of industry representatives and sustainability experts.
Representing IFEMA MADRID, the jury will include the FITUR Management and the Quality and Sustainability Management teams.
The composition of the jury will be made public when the award decision is announced.
- Selection of the winner
The jury will evaluate the information provided through the questionnaire, as well as the impact of the actions, their degree of innovation, and the effort involved in their implementation. It will also take into account the contribution made to fostering a culture of sustainability within the exhibition and meetings industry.
The jury may grant the award to as many entries ex aequo as it considers appropriate, or may decide not to award the prize.
- Award
The prize consists of an official certificate and a trophy, which will be presented after the announcement of the jury’s decision at a ceremony whose date will be communicated to the winner well in advance.
- Publicity
The award will be announced through a press release issued jointly with the results of the other awards organized by FITUR.
Winners of the FITUR 2026 Sustainable Stands Awards
- Cantabria, For its part, the organisation bases its project on the development of its own platform, ‘Inicia 2030’, designed to monitor its sustainability objectives and outcomes. It also has a dismantling protocol in place to avoid the demolition of the exhibition space.
- Grupo Piñero has been recognised at this year’s event for its comprehensive sustainability project, which represents a balanced, holistic commitment and is making progress by involving all stakeholders, including visitors.
- Ayuntamiento de Castelldefels He has been recognised for structuring his commitment to sustainability around cultural identity, centred on such a quintessentially local feature as the beach bar, which not only serves as an aesthetic reference but also provides the material for the decking and other elements of the stand.
- On this occasion, Galicia has been recognised for its commitment to innovation through a textile material produced by recycling more than 50,000 plastic bottles, which was used to construct the panels for the stand.
FITUR Active Tourism Award
The aim of the 32nd edition of the FITUR Active Tourism Awards is to promote the development and marketing of the tourism industry and to showcase the highest-quality tourism products, both nationally and internationally.
It is a platform for raising awareness of the range of products and services available in the active tourism sector and, as such, serves as a distribution channel for both tour operators and end consumers.
- FITUR and AireLibre magazine announce the 32nd FITUR Active Tourism Awards.
- The FITUR Active Tourism Awards aim to recognize companies and professionals who develop high-quality tourism products and promote experiential tourism aligned with the sustainability principles that should guide the tourism industry.
- Participants. FITUR 2027 exhibitors and co-exhibitors may submit their tourism products based on culture, nature, adventure, food and wine tourism, or any other experiential activity designed in accordance with the principles of economic, environmental, and/or social sustainability for destinations and local communities.
- Product evaluation criteria for selection
- Original and innovative product.
- Product that contributes to sustainable tourism development from an economic, environmental, and/or social perspective.
- Quality of the product’s image and marketing materials.
- Participation procedure. Each entity may submit only one product. To participate, applicants must complete, before November 27, 2026, the following form: REGISTRATION FORM and follow the instructions provided regarding the descriptive materials that must accompany the application.
- The jury.
The jury will be made up of representatives from AireLibre magazine and FITUR. The jury will grant a maximum of four awards: two in the national category and two in the international category.
The jury’s decision and the notification of the winners of the FITUR Active Tourism Awards will take place before January 13, 2027.
Any of the awards may be declared void at the discretion of the jury.
The jury’s decision shall be final and not subject to appeal.

27th Tribuna FITUR – Jorge Vila Fredera FITUR 2026 call for applications
FITUR and AECIT (Spanish Association of Scientific Experts in Tourism) organised the 27th FITUR - Jorge Vila Fradera Tribune.
- Objective: To select an unpublished work of research in the field of tourism, publish it and disseminate it in the academic and training world.
- Structure of the call for entries: All tourism research papers from Spain and Latin America, submitted by individuals of legal age, are eligible to compete.
#01 FITUR announces the 27th edition of the FITUR-Jorge Vila Fradera Tribune, with the collaboration of AECIT.
#02 The aim of this call is to select an unpublished work of research in the field of tourism, edit it and disseminate its publication in the academic and training world.
#03 This is an annual call for papers.
#04 Works must be submitted in Spanish, by natural persons of legal age.
#05 The geographical scope of the research work is international.
#06 A Technical-Scientific Selection Committee will be formed from among the members of AECIT, which will include the sponsors of this Tribune and representatives of FITUR. This Committee will be chaired by a member of the AECIT Board of Directors and will have a casting vote in the event of a tie. It may select a maximum of one work, and the decision may be declared void.
#07 The Selection Committee will establish objective scales for the evaluation of the works presented.
#08 The Committee's decision will be irrevocable.
#09 The Technical-Scientific Committee will select a maximum of four finalist works, which will be presented at the technical conference organised by AECIT during FITUR. In order to obtain the award, the selected work must have been presented by the author or one of its authors at the technical conference. The presentation must be made in person. Only in the case of force majeure will electronic presentation be permitted, and such force majeure must be duly justified. In any case, it will be up to the members of the Technical-Scientific Committee to decide whether the reason given for the telematic presentation is adequately justified. Finally, the Technical-Scientific Committee will give preference to papers submitted in person.
#10 Under the aforementioned conditions, the work may not exceed a maximum of 150 pages (excluding annexes).
#11 Works that have been presented in previous editions of the FITUR-Jorge Vila Fradera Tribune Award will not be accepted in this call for entries.
#12 In order to guarantee anonymity in the evaluation process, entries must include three PDF's with the following information:
- First PDF:
- Work submitted for the 27th edition FITUR-Jorge Vila Fradera Tribune Award, with the title of the work and a pseudonym.
- The name and surname(s) of the author(s), or their affiliation, will never appear, neither on the cover page nor on the inside pages of the work.
- Second PDF:
- A brief summary, headed with the title of the work and the pseudonym, in which the objectives of the work, the methodology used and the results obtained are clearly and briefly explained.
- Third PDF:
- Photocopy of the identity card or passport of the author or authors of the work, as well as a brief CV of each of them.
- Word document
- It must include name, surname, address and e-mail address.
Works that do not comply with the above indications will be excluded.
The above documents must be sent in PDF to the address [email protected] before 12 December 2025.
#13 The selected work will be acknowledged by the FITUR-Jorge Vila Fradera Tribune and will be edit in Spanish in online format.
#14 The author's rights will be recognised and authorisation will be obligatory in order to assign the publishing and dissemination rights to the organisation and sponsors.
#15 The decision will be communicated during the days of FITUR 2026.
#16 The winning author will be invited to the annual awards ceremony organised by FITUR in the months following the fair.
#17 Finalists who have not been awarded the FITUR-Jorge Vila Fradera Tribune prize will receive a certificate of finalist work issued by AECIT.
#18 All participants expressly accept these rules.

Fitur 4all Awards
The FITUR 4all Awards, organized by IMPULSA IGUALDAD in collaboration with FITUR, aim to give visibility, thank and encourage commitment to the development and promotion of inclusive tourism and is aimed at national and international destinations, companies, organizations and institutions in the tourism sector.
